一种安全的同质化远程放疗协作的方法及系统A method and system for safe homogeneous remote radiotherapy collaboration

技术领域technical field

本发明涉及医疗质量管理系统技术领域,尤其涉及一种安全的同质化 远程放疗协作的方法及系统。The present invention relates to the technical field of medical quality management systems, in particular to a method and system for safe homogeneous remote radiotherapy collaboration.

背景技术Background technique

放射治疗作为临床上治疗恶性肿瘤的三大基本疗法之一,越来越受到 医务工作者的重视。就放射治疗领域而言,相对于大型现代化的中心医院, 二级医院存在放疗设备的差异和放疗人才的短缺。另外,由于现有放疗设 备厂商不同,系统的相容性差,导致目前放疗领域的协作较少,只有专家 上门会诊这一种手段,大部分二级医院的患者无法得到中心医院同质化的 治疗方案,使患者更愿意涌入中心医院进行治疗,从而导致中心医院患者过多不堪重负。Radiation therapy, as one of the three basic therapies for treating malignant tumors clinically, has been paid more and more attention by medical workers. As far as the field of radiotherapy is concerned, compared with large modern central hospitals, there are differences in radiotherapy equipment and a shortage of radiotherapy talents in secondary hospitals. In addition, due to the different manufacturers of existing radiotherapy equipment and the poor compatibility of the systems, there is little collaboration in the field of radiotherapy at present. Only expert consultations are available, and most patients in secondary hospitals cannot receive homogeneous treatment from central hospitals. The plan makes patients more willing to flood into the central hospital for treatment, which leads to overwhelmed by too many patients in the central hospital.

具体实施方式detailed description

下面结合附图对本发明做详细描述。The present invention will be described in detail below in conjunction with the accompanying drawings.

实施例1Example 1

如图1所示,一种安全的同质化远程放疗协作的方法,包括:As shown in Figure 1, a safe and homogeneous teleradiotherapy collaboration method includes:

1)、二级医院通过同质化远程放疗协助平台向中心医院提出协助申请;1) Second-level hospitals submit assistance applications to central hospitals through the homogeneous remote radiotherapy assistance platform;

所述协助申请包括:申请医院名称及代号,申请物理师名称及代号, 患者个人资料,患者初步诊断信息。The assistance application includes: application for the name and code of the hospital, application for the name and code of a physicist, personal data of the patient, and preliminary diagnosis information of the patient.

2)、通过所述同质化远程放疗协助平台,中心医院专家人员对申请进 行初步审核并反馈;2) Through the homogeneous remote radiotherapy assistance platform, experts from the central hospital conduct preliminary review and feedback on the application;

在协助端上,各申请以提交先后顺序以表格形式排列。中心医院专家 人员根据患者信息进行初步审核以确定是否需要进行远程协助:若审核通 过,向申请端返回通过信息并提交协助时间;若审核不通过,向申请端返 回不通过信息。On the assistance side, applications are arranged in table form in the order of submission. The experts of the central hospital conduct a preliminary review based on the patient information to determine whether remote assistance is needed: if the review is passed, the pass information is returned to the application end and the assistance time is submitted; if the review fails, the fail information is returned to the application end.

所述同质化远程放疗协助平台将所接收的协助申请以表格形式汇总并 显示。The homogeneous remote radiotherapy assistance platform summarizes and displays the received assistance applications in a form.

3)、二级医院在约定时间向中心医院协助端提出加密远程协助请求, 中心医院专家人员通过解密实现远程协助操作,获取访问资料库权限;3) The secondary hospital submits an encrypted remote assistance request to the assistance terminal of the central hospital at the agreed time, and the experts of the central hospital realize the remote assistance operation through decryption and obtain access to the database;

中心医院专家人员对二级医院客户端进行远程桌面操作,访问患者资 料,需要说明的是,该远程桌面连接需要进行安全性的保证。包括如下步 骤:更改协助端输出的远程桌面端口并开放被协助端相应防火墙端口,以 阻止被协助端接收恶意远程桌面访问申请;通过SSL协议以实现对通信过 程的加密以及对协助端和被协助端计算机进行特殊的身份验证。Experts from the central hospital perform remote desktop operations on the client side of the secondary hospital to access patient data. It should be noted that the remote desktop connection needs to be secured. It includes the following steps: change the remote desktop port output by the assisting end and open the corresponding firewall port of the assisted end to prevent the assisted end from receiving malicious remote desktop access applications; use the SSL protocol to realize encryption of the communication process and to communicate between the assisting end and the assisted end The end computer performs special authentication.

4)、根据患者的资料库中病历信息,与二级医院医生进行实时远程会 诊,制定同质化放疗计划。4) According to the medical record information in the patient database, conduct real-time remote consultation with doctors in secondary hospitals to formulate a homogeneous radiotherapy plan.

中心医院专家人员通过远程桌面访问二级医院客户端TPS软件,通过 虚拟鼠标和虚拟键盘技术在二级医院客户端TPS软件上进行放射治疗计划 的制定。经双方人员共同签字确认后,该放射治疗计划方可实施。Experts from the central hospital access the client TPS software of the secondary hospital through remote desktops, and formulate radiation treatment plans on the client TPS software of the secondary hospital through virtual mouse and virtual keyboard technology. The radiotherapy plan can only be implemented after being signed and confirmed by both parties.

需要说明的是,在被协助端,通过虚拟鼠标和虚拟键盘进行的操作需 要对其操作日志进行保存记录,以保证计划的真实性和可靠性。It should be noted that, on the assisted side, operations performed through the virtual mouse and virtual keyboard need to be recorded in operation logs to ensure the authenticity and reliability of the plan.

实施例3Example 3

如图3所示,对申请预约同质化远程放疗协助的过程进行详细说明。As shown in Figure 3, the process of applying for an appointment for homogeneous remote radiotherapy assistance is described in detail.

在步骤S202中,二级医院申请端S201向同质化远程放疗协助平台提 出预约申请。预约申请内容需包括如下内容:申请医院名称及代号,申请 物理师名称及代号,患者个人资料,患者初步诊断信息。In step S202, the secondary hospital application terminal S201 submits an appointment application to the homogeneous remote radiotherapy assistance platform. The content of the appointment application must include the following: the name and code of the applying hospital, the name and code of the physicist applying, personal information of the patient, and preliminary diagnosis information of the patient.

在步骤S203中,中心医院服务端通过同质化远程放疗协助平台对预约 申请列表进行访问。In step S203, the central hospital server accesses the appointment application list through the homogeneous remote radiotherapy assistance platform.

在步骤S204中,中心医院服务端确认通过申请。In step S204, the central hospital server confirms that the application is approved.

在步骤S205中,中心医院服务端通过同质化远程放疗协助平台向二级 医院申请端返回通过结果并预约协助时间。In step S205, the server of the central hospital returns the passing result and makes an appointment for assistance to the application terminal of the secondary hospital through the homogeneous remote radiotherapy assistance platform.

在步骤S206中,中心医院服务端不通过申请。In step S206, the central hospital server does not approve the application.

在步骤S207中,中心医院服务端通过同质化远程放疗协助平台向二级 医院申请端返回不通过的结果。In step S207, the service end of the central hospital returns a result of failure to the application end of the secondary hospital through the homogeneous remote radiotherapy assistance platform.

实施例4Example 4

如图4所示,对同质化远程放疗协助平台实现远程协助的过程进行详 细说明。As shown in Figure 4, the process of realizing remote assistance on the homogeneous remote radiotherapy assistance platform is described in detail.

在步骤S302中,二级医院申请端S301在约定时间通过同质化远程放 疗协助平台向中心医院服务端S303提出远程协助申请。In step S302, the secondary hospital application terminal S301 submits a remote assistance application to the central hospital server S303 through the homogeneous remote radiotherapy assistance platform at the agreed time.

在步骤S304中,中心医院服务端通过远程协助申请。In step S304, the server of the central hospital applies for remote assistance.

在步骤S305中,中心医院服务端在保证安全性的条件下通过远程桌面 访问二级医院申请端。In step S305, the central hospital server accesses the secondary hospital application terminal through the remote desktop under the condition of ensuring security.

在步骤S306中,中心医院服务端通过远程桌面在二级医院申请端上查 看患者病例,并通过媒体装置实现语音或视频通讯进行远程会诊。In step S306, the central hospital server checks the patient's case on the application terminal of the secondary hospital through the remote desktop, and realizes voice or video communication through the media device for remote consultation.

在步骤S307中,中心医院服务端通过远程桌面在二级医院申请端TPS 软件上根据申请端固有设备参数制定合理的放射治疗计划。In step S307, the server of the central hospital formulates a reasonable radiotherapy plan on the TPS software of the application terminal of the secondary hospital through the remote desktop according to the inherent equipment parameters of the application terminal.

在步骤S308中,二级医院申请端和中心医院服务端分别对制定的放射 治疗计划进行签字确认。In step S308, the application end of the secondary hospital and the server end of the central hospital respectively sign and confirm the formulated radiotherapy plan.

在步骤S309中,中心医院服务端不通过协助申请。In step S309, the central hospital server does not pass the assistance application.

在步骤S310中,中心医院服务端通过同质化远程放疗协助平台向二级 医院申请端返回不通过结果。In step S310, the service end of the central hospital returns a failure result to the application end of the secondary hospital through the homogeneous remote radiotherapy assistance platform.

本发明提供一种同质化远程放疗协作的方法,该方法可以使二级医院 通过同质化远程放疗协助平台向中心医院提出同质化远程放疗协作申请, 由中心医院根据患者信息进行远程会诊,无需患者影像资料的传输,直接 在二级医院自有的设备参数的基础上制定出精准合理的放疗计划,以实现 中心医院专家在当地就可以对二级医院的患者进行同质化放射治疗服务。The present invention provides a method for homogeneous remote radiotherapy cooperation, which enables the secondary hospital to submit an application for homogeneous remote radiotherapy cooperation to the central hospital through the homogeneous remote radiotherapy assistance platform, and the central hospital conducts remote consultation based on patient information , without the transmission of patient image data, an accurate and reasonable radiotherapy plan can be formulated directly on the basis of the equipment parameters of the second-level hospital, so that experts from the central hospital can perform homogeneous radiation therapy on patients in the second-level hospital locally Serve.
